Los Angeles, California Jan 12, 2026 (Issuewire.com) - Lawrence Lambelet brings a lifetime of intellectual curiosity and problem-solving to the forefront in his new book, Musings: Vietnam, Conjectures, and More. This eclectic collection of essays dives into everything from the Vietnam War and mathematical mysteries to spiritual health and the futility of dietingwith each topic approached from the unique lens of a seasoned thinker who has spent decades in engineering, patent law, and scientific inquiry.

With nine essays ranging from deeply technical to disarmingly personal, Lambelet combines storytelling with analysis, inviting readers to explore unresolved questions that still captivate him. He dissects the logic of the ABC mathematical conjecture, considers the complexities of free will, and revisits his reflections on Vietnam with poignant commentary about modern conflicts.

Rather than offering definitive solutions, Lambelet examines the process of thinking itselfshowing that curiosity is just as valuable as certainty. His essay on Vietnam, for instance, questions the purpose and consequences of war, while his musings on spiritual health and intermittent fasting weave personal experiences with practical wisdom.

As a former engineer and patent practitioner, Lambelet holds 23 patents and is best known for developing the Dialpak® birth control packaging, now archived at the Smithsonian. His analytical mind and diverse career provide a rich foundation for the books meditative yet accessible tone.

Set in the quiet isolation of rural America, BENEATH THE OAK follows Alyssa Ward, a grieving woman forced to confront the shadows of her past when she returns to her childhood home after her mothers sudden death. What she expects to be a simple homecoming becomes a descent into a generational nightmare. The massive oak tree looming behind the houseonce a symbol of comfortnow pulses with an eerie, oppressive presence. At night, whispers seep from its roots, and ghostly silhouettes gather beneath its branches, watching, waiting.

As Alyssa sorts through her mothers belongings, she discovers a series of journals revealing a dark family curse tied to the ancient tree. For generations, the Ward family has been tormented by a spirit bound to the oakone that selects a single family member to keep beneath its roots. When Alyssa begins experiencing visions of a young girl calling her name, begging for release, she realizes the curse is awakening once more.

The deeper Alyssa digs into her familys past, the more the veil between the living and the dead unravels. The spirit beneath the oak soon reveals its true identitysomeone Alyssa once knew, someone she unknowingly abandoned. To break the curse, Alyssa must confront buried memories, longforgotten guilt, and a supernatural force determined to claim her as its next offering. The battle becomes not only for her life, but for her soul.
